Abstract
Compartment syndrome is a syndrome that can happened in any anatomical area with increased pressure in a confined body space, resulting in poor blood flow, cellular damage, and organ dysfunction. • One of it is abdominal compartment syndrome and it is a serious condition that occurs when the pressure in the abdominal cavity rises above 20 mmHg and causes endorgan damage [1,4]. • Abdominal compartment syndrome may occur after conditions such as peritonitis, intestinal obstruction, laparoscopic procedures, or abdominal tumors4. • Leakage from the urinary tract may cause accumulation of urine in the peritoneal cavity
